oracle转换函数 to_date,to_char,to_number问题,求指教!issue_date:出票时间 timestamp类型pay_time:支付时间 timestamp类型我要求平均出票时间,就涉及到 (issue_date - pay_time)然后求和,但是求和需要转换!

来源:学生作业帮助网 编辑:六六作业网 时间:2024/11/28 20:11:49
oracle转换函数to_date,to_char,to_number问题,求指教!issue_date:出票时间timestamp类型pay_time:支付时间timestamp类型我要求平均出票时

oracle转换函数 to_date,to_char,to_number问题,求指教!issue_date:出票时间 timestamp类型pay_time:支付时间 timestamp类型我要求平均出票时间,就涉及到 (issue_date - pay_time)然后求和,但是求和需要转换!
oracle转换函数 to_date,to_char,to_number问题,求指教!
issue_date:出票时间 timestamp类型
pay_time:支付时间 timestamp类型
我要求平均出票时间,就涉及到 (issue_date - pay_time)然后求和,但是求和需要转换!求大神赐教!
to_date
to_number
to_char都不行
提示如下:
select sum(to_number(issue_date - pay_time)) from order_flight --提示无效数字

select sum(to_date(issue_date - pay_time, 'yyyy-MM-dd')) from order_flight --提示数据类型不一致 应该为number但是却获得date

select sum(to_char(issue_date - pay_time, )) from order_flight --提示无效数字

oracle转换函数 to_date,to_char,to_number问题,求指教!issue_date:出票时间 timestamp类型pay_time:支付时间 timestamp类型我要求平均出票时间,就涉及到 (issue_date - pay_time)然后求和,但是求和需要转换!
将timestamp + 0 后,转换为date,再相减:
select sum((issue_date+0) - (pay_time+0) )) from order_flight

oracle转换函数 to_date,to_char,to_number问题,求指教!issue_date:出票时间 timestamp类型pay_time:支付时间 timestamp类型我要求平均出票时间,就涉及到 (issue_date - pay_time)然后求和,但是求和需要转换! Oracle 格式转换 to_number(to_char(to_date)) 转换.详细见补充.select to_number(to_char(add_months(to_date(to_char(201403)||'01','yyyymmdd') ,-1),'YYYYMM')) from dual;原本预期输入 201403 输出 20140201结果实测 输出 201402 .如何 oracle中,25-09-14怎么转换成日期格式:yyyy-mm-dd,已经试过to_char()和to_date(),都报错;FUNCTION get_order_date(p_segment1 IN VARCHAR2, p_organization_code IN VARCHAR2) RETURN VARCHAR2 IS RESULT VARCHAR2(1000); BEGIN FOR cur I oracle中的nvl函数 Oracle中获取系统时间前一天的函数为sysdate - interval '1' dayOracle中获取系统时间前一天的函数为sysdate - interval '1' day 现在有一个语句to_date('0827’,’mm/dd’) 我想把语句里面的时间换成系统时间 character到底是什么?我在看PL/SQL时看到:使用TO_DATE内嵌函数可以将CHARACTER类型的值转换成DATE类型的值,想问问这character类型到底是什么类型 Oracle round函数是什么意思?怎么运用? Oracle中lag函数怎么用 oracle中的over函数怎么用的, oracle输出的日期有英文DECLAREnos date;m_vars date;BEGINm_vars :=to_date('&nos','YYYY-MM-DD');dbms_output.put_line(m_vars);END;输出是10-OCT-03为什么啊 我想要的是yyyy-mm-dd ORACLE数据库中JOB的问题!begin sys.dbms_job.submit(job => :job, what => 'insert_res_add;', next_date => to_date('24-02-2010 01:00:00', 'dd-mm-yyyy hh24:mi:ss'), interval => 'TRUNC( to_date(&&1)中&&是什么意思 oracle数据库中sqrt函数默认保留几位小数? oracle中函数rank中的over是什么意思?如题 oracle 取两者之间的较小值用什么函数 oracle是什么意思, oracle otn oracle这句什么意思dbms_stats.gather_table_statsexec dbms_stats.gather_table_stats( user,'T' );